Will Smith currently uses a Louisville Slugger bat, Rawlings Custom glove, and Nike Alpha Huarache Elite 4 cleats. Will Smith’s Bat: Louisville Slugger

Will Smith swings a Louisville Slugger bat, a brand with a legendary history in baseball. While the exact model is his own custom turn, it highlights his preference for the feel and performance of wood bats from this iconic manufacturer.

Will Smith’s Glove: Rawlings Custom

Behind the plate, Smith uses a Rawlings catcher’s mitt. Rawlings is a top choice for professional catchers, known for its durability and the way it forms a perfect pocket.

Will Smith’s Cleats: Nike Alpha Huarache Elite 4

Smith wears Nike Alpha Huarache Elite 4 cleats, which provide the comfort and traction needed for quick movements behind the plate and on the basepaths.

Will Smith’s Catcher’s Gear: Nike Diamond Elite

Smith is fully outfitted in Nike’s Diamond Elite catcher’s gear. This includes his chest protector and leg guards, offering elite protection and mobility.
